Jalandhar, August 26

Advertisement

Adampur resident Charan Das Jaggi, son of Pritam Lal Jaggi, alias Pritam Kabaria, has won the first prize of Rs 2.5 crore of Rakhi Bumper-2024.

Pritam said his family has been into the scrap dealing business for several decades.

He said to date he could not build his house and shop due to financial constraints.

He added that he had been buying lotteries for the past 50 years, when a lottery ticket would cost just Rs 1. He said he and his wife Anita Jaggi bought ticket number 452749 from an agent who came to sell lottery from Jalandhar last week. It was issued by Luthra Lottery Agency, Jalandhar.

He said on Sunday morning, when he saw the result of the lottery in the newspaper, he came to know that the first prize was ticket number 452749.

However, he did not reveal about it to anyone and went to the Nirankari satsang house in Adampur as per his routine.

When he came home, he got a call from the lottery operator from Jalandhar that he had won the first prize of Rs 2.5 crore of Rakhi bumper.

He said he would spend 25 per cent of the prize money on social service and for the welfare of poor.
